angle valves, also known as corner valves or stop valves, are an essential component of plumbing systems. These valves are designed to control the flow of water in a pipe by opening or closing the passage. They are typically installed at a 90-degree angle to the pipe, hence the name "angle valve".
Angle valves are commonly used in household plumbing systems to regulate the flow of water to sinks, toilets, and appliances such as washing machines and dishwashers. They are also used in commercial and industrial settings, where precise control of water flow is necessary.
One of the key advantages of angle valves is their compact design, which allows them to be installed in tight spaces where a traditional valve may not fit. This makes them ideal for use in areas such as under sinks or behind toilets.
Angle valves are typically made of durable materials such as brass or stainless steel, which ensures their longevity and resistance to corrosion. They are also equipped with a handle that can be turned to open or close the valve, allowing for easy operation.
In addition to controlling the flow of water, angle valves also serve as a convenient shut-off point in case of emergencies or repairs. By closing the valve, the water supply to a specific area can be quickly and easily cut off, preventing potential water damage.
Overall, angle valves are a versatile and essential component of plumbing systems, providing precise control over water flow and serving as a reliable shut-off point when needed. Their compact design, durability, and ease of use make them a valuable asset in both residential and commercial plumbing applications.

Features:
Versatile Installation: Angle valves are designed to be installed at a corner or angle in the plumbing system, allowing for easy connection to water supply lines, sinks, toilets, or appliances.
Compact Design: Angle valves have a compact and space-saving design, ma
king them ideal for installation in tight spaces where a straight valve may not fit.
Control Lever: Angle valves typically have a control lever or handle that can be turned to open or close the valve, allowing for quick and convenient control of water flow.
Durable Construction: Angle valves are constructed from durable materials such as brass, stainless steel, or chrome-plated finishes to ensure longevity and resistance to corrosion.
Leak-proof Seal: Angle valves are equipped with a sealing mechanism, such as a rubber washer or O-ring, to create a watertight seal when the valve is closed, preventing leaks and ensuring efficient water control.
Threaded Connections: Angle valves feature male or female threaded connections that allow for easy installation and secure attachment to water pipes, hoses, or fixtures.
Pressure Regulation: Some angle valves come with pressure-regulating features that help control the water pressure, preventing water hammer effects and ensuring a steady flow of water.
Compatibility: Angle valves are compatible with a variety of plumbing systems, including copper, PVC, PEX, and other piping materials commonly used in residential and commercial buildings.
Variety of Sizes: Angle valves are available in different sizes, ranging from 1/2 inch to 3/4 inch, to accommodate various plumbing applications and flow requirements.
Ease of Maintenance: Angle valves are designed for easy maintenance and repair. Some models have removable handles or cartridge inserts that can be replaced if needed to ensure continued functionality.
Temperature Resistance: High-quality angle valves are capable of withstanding hot and cold water temperatures, making them suitable for both hot and cold water supply lines.
Application scope;
Residential Plumbing: Angle valves are widely used in residential plumbing systems for controlling the water supply to fixtures such as sinks, toilets, bidets, and appliances like washing machines and dishwashers. They are essential components in k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and utility areas within homes.
Commercial Buildings: In commercial properties such as offices, restaurants, hotels, schools, hospitals, and retail establishments, angle valves are installed to regulate water flow to sinks, toilets, urinals, drinking fountains, and other water fixtures. They are integral to the smooth operation of plumbing systems in commercial buildings.
Industrial Facilities: Angle valves play a crucial role in industrial facilities, manufacturing plants, and warehouses where there is a need to control water supply to machinery, equipment, cooling systems, and wash stations. Their durability and reliability make them suitable for demanding industrial applications.
HVAC Systems: Angle valves are used in he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ems to regulate the flow of water through heating coils, radiators, boilers, and chillers. They help maintain temperature control and energy efficiency in HVAC equipment.
Fire Protection Systems: Angle valves are employed in fire protection systems, including sprinkler systems and fire hydrants, to control the flow of water in case of fire emergencies. They are critical components for ensuring proper water distribution for fire suppression.
Public Facilities: Angle valves are installed in public restrooms, recreational facilities, parks, municipal buildings, and community centers to control water supply to washbasins, toilets, showers, and drinking fountains. They contribute to the efficient functioning of plumbing fixtures in public spaces.
Water Treatment Plants: In water treatment facilities and wastewater treatment plants, angle valves are used to regulate the flow of water, chemicals, and fluids in treatment processes, pipelines, and filtration systems. They help maintain operational efficiency in water treatment operations.
Irrigation Systems: Angle valves are integrated into irrigation systems for gardens, landscaping, agricultural fields, and golf courses to control the flow of water to sprinklers, drip lines, and irrigation emitters. They enable precise water distribution for efficient irrigation practices.
